Odell Beckham Jr. is still the subject of interest from multiple teams, and in a couple of weeks, we expect him to sign with a team. The Dallas Cowboys and the New York Giants are seen as the frontrunners to land OBJ.

On Thanksgiving Day, the Cowboys defeated the Giants 28-20, and many believed they had gained an edge in the OBJ sweepstakes. However, former NFL player Rob Ninkovich believes the Cowboys would be better off without the star receiver.

Here's what Rob Ninkovich said about Odell Beckham Jr. on ESPN's Get up:

"I don't think the Cowboys need that, and listen, offensively, there's only so many possessions and there's only so many touches to go around. I get it, OBJ is a guy that you see as a polarizing figure who made a heck of a catch about 10 years ago."

Ninkovich added:

"I get he was great last year in the Superbowl, but he also hurt his knee. And it's the second time he hurt his knee. And that concerns me having to ACLs because I know from experience having torn my ACL that when you come back, you don't feel that great."

He continued:

"I don't think the Cowboys are going to get the benefits out of it from signing him. What the public and the outside fan base is going on is going to want to expect from a player like obj if they do sign him, so I don't think it's a great fit."

Odell is a star player that suits the Dallas Cowboys well, but this is a young team looking quite promising. The addition of OBJ could go either way for Dallas.

They do need a receiver, and last season, Odell Beckham Jr. showed he is still an impactful player, but the baggage that will come along with him might impact others.

Odell Beckham Jr.'s close friend Von Miller suffered a horrific injury against the Detroit Lions on Thanksgiving Day. The damage looked serious, and OBJ tweeted:

"God plz watch over @VonMiller !!! Place your hands over him Lord. I ask that it not be anything too serious. I love u brother prayin hard!"

The extent of Miller's injury is unknown, but he could be ruled out for the season. If he is ruled out this season, it would be a massive loss for the Buffalo Bills, who have dealt with many injuries this season.

Odell Beckham Jr. has also been linked with the Buffalo Bills, and everyone is eagerly waiting for his decision.
